Step-by-step explanation:
We can use Bayes Formula,
[tex] P(N|C) = \frac{P(C|N)*P(N)}{P(C)} [/tex]
We know every single value of that expression except P(C). We can calculate C by dividing into 2 cases: if the customer is new or not.
By the total probability theorem, we know that P(C) = P(C|N)*P(N) + P(C|N')*P(N') = 0.5*0.8 + 0.7*0.2 = 0.4+0.14 = 0.54
We replace P(C) on the equation above and we obtain
[tex] P(N|C) = \frac{P(C|N)*P(N)}{P(C)} = \frac{0.5*0.8}{0.54} = 0.7407[/tex]
Thus, P(N|C) = 0.7407. Answer c is correct
